Reviews:

Author: Geronimo1967
“Bambi” is born into an idyllic forest life – his father is the bull stag; his mother an adoring hind and he quickly befriends all the other animals in his gloriously technicolour world. He learns to walk, to talk, even to ice-skate with the help of his bunny pal “Thumper” and he encounters the joys and perils of the seasons from sunny summers to freezing winters too. All is perfect until human beings take an hand – then, alongside his father and his friends, he must face the more brutal realities of life. The animation is gorgeous – simplistic, perhaps, by 2020 standards – but the artistic craftsmanship of the drawings and the score more than adequately compensate for that. There is a minimum of dialogue – the images tell the story, and they do it superbly.
